Religious Collections Cataloging Librarian Location: Bloomington Position Summary Indiana University Bloomington Libraries’ Lilly Library seeks a collaborative, enthusiastic, and innovative librarian to serve as the inaugural Religious Collections Cataloging Librarian. Funded by a dedicated endowment , the cataloger will work closely with the Head, Cataloging & Description, and the Curator of Religious Collections to describe and make available Lilly Library materials relating to religion and spirituality in all formats. The Lilly Library is Indiana University’s principal rare books, manuscripts, and special collections library. The library’s actively used and dynamically growing collections encompass manuscripts, printed books, and devotional objects spanning a wide chronological and geographical span. Core strengths include European medieval and Renaissance religious manuscripts, early printed Bibles in many languages, hymnological resources, and rare works produced in the Spanish, Portuguese, and Dutch colonial worlds. The collections also feature significant materials from Asian and Islamic religious traditions. Active collecting areas include pilgrimage, religious materials created for and by children, and religious narratives related to disability. The majority of these collections are in English, Latin, Italian, French, German, and Spanish, with other languages represented in smaller numbers. Responsibilities Reporting to the Head, Cataloging & Description, the Religious Collections Cataloging Librarian will: Serve as the primary cataloger for all Lilly Library materials relating to religion and spirituality in all formats. Organize and lead special projects relating to intellectual and physical control of Lilly Library materials relating to religion and spirituality. Collaborate with the Curator of Religious Collections on interpreting and increasing awareness of the Lilly Library’s collections relating to religion and spirituality. Participate in departmental conversations and contribute to internal policy development and documentation. Keep abreast of national developments in cataloging standards and best practices as they emerge and develop. Engage in service and professional development activities that enrich the librarian’s practice and contribute meaningfully to the profession. ALA-accredited graduate degree in library or information science or international equivalent. Candidates with an advanced degree in a relevant subject area and relevant experience in a library setting will also be considered. A minimum of 2 years’ professional cataloging experience, including original and complex copy cataloging. Demonstrated working knowledge of the following metadata content standards and tools: MARC21; Resource Description and Access (RDA); Library of Congress classification and subject headings. Reading knowledge of one or more languages represented in the Lilly Library’s collections of religion and spirituality. Demonstrated working knowledge of cataloging standards, best practices, tools, and emerging trends within the field. Demonstrated ability to communicate clearly and knowledgeably in multiple modalities. Additional Qualifications Candidates do not need to meet all preferred qualifications to be considered for this position. Demonstrated experience using one or more of the Descriptive Cataloging of Rare Materials (DCRM) manuals and/or Descriptive Cataloging of Ancient, Medieval, Renaissance, and Early Modern Manuscripts (AMREMM) to create original catalog records. Demonstrated working knowledge of the Program for Cooperative Cataloging (PCC) Name Authority Cooperative Program (NACO) and/or the PCC Subject Authority Cooperative Program (SACO). Experience with Anglo-American Cataloging Rules (2nd ed.). Demonstrated experience with medieval, renaissance, and/or early modern European manuscripts. Reading knowledge of Latin. Previous experience or academic work in the history of religion and/or religious studies, broadly defined. Supervisory and/or project management experience. Demonstrated experience collaborating with multiple stakeholders. Demonstrated experience communicating with and/or writing for a non-specialist audience. Demonstrated engagement in service and professional development activities on a local and/or national level.
